Abstract
PWTD (plane wave time domain) formulations that arise from nonuniform and uniform sampling of transient plane wave patterns are presented and their advantages and disadvantages discussed. In addition, a hybrid scheme that optimally leverages the advantages of both sampling schemes across PWTD levels within a multilevel framework is presented. This hybrid scheme is argued to be especially suitable for parallel implementation. The accuracy of the proposed hybrid scheme is verified by a numerical example.
